Tesco wont give me my PAC
My last payment for my contract comes out this month then its over.
I am moving to 3 for a month by month deal until I feel the need to get a new phone.
I asked Tesco today for my PAC code and they said they would have to charge me around £30 quid to get my code as it's leaving early cancellation. I said I would wait to switch it over but he wouldn't oblige, that doesn't seem right?

You have to give notice 30 days before you wish to leave. You have come to the end of your minimum contract term, but to leave you have to give 30 days notice.
They will give you your PAC, I guess what you meant was they won't give you your PAC for free, which they are right to do if you haven't provided enough notice period.0 -

The PAC is free. However if you use it to port within minimum term then an ETC may be chageable. But they can't charge you for providing the PAC or withold it until you pay.No free lunch, and no free laptop
